Firstly, it's essential to understand the types of roofing materials available and how each performs under different climatic conditions. Asphalt shingles, for instance, are popular due to their cost-effectiveness and ease of installation. They are durable enough for a range of climates but may not be the best choice for areas with extreme heat as they can warp over time under high temperatures. However, they offer excellent protection in milder climates and can withstand moderate weather conditions well.

Metal roofing is another option gaining popularity due to its durability and resistance to harsh weather. It's particularly suited for areas prone to heavy rainfall or snowfall because metal roofs are excellent at shedding water. Moreover, metal reflects sunlight, making it an energy-efficient option for hotter climates. This characteristic helps in reducing cooling costs during summer months. Despite the higher initial cost, metal roofs require less maintenance, often making them a cost-effective choice in the long run.

In regions experiencing frequent storms or high winds, slate or tile roofing might be the ideal choice. These materials are both heavy and durable, providing excellent resistance against wind damage. Slate roofs, while more costly, offer a lifespan of up to 100 years, making them perfect for homeowners seeking a long-term investment. Tile roofs, particularly popular in Mediterranean and Spanish-style homes, also perform excellently under sunny skies, providing natural ventilation that aids in temperature regulation.

Wood shakes and shingles offer a natural look that is appealing to many homeowners. These materials excel in dryer climates due to their porous nature which can become problematic in areas of high humidity or frequent rain, as they are prone to mold and rot if not properly maintained. However, with the right treatment, wood roofs can offer excellent insulation and a rustic aesthetic.
